## Further reading

The Ledgerglass audit-log viewer renders immutable events from the Stonebook store; it never writes back. For your review, the retention policy, redaction rules for personal data, and the access-control matrix for viewer roles are maintained separately from this repository. The complete design document, including the threat model and signing-chain verification details, is published on the internal page below.

runbook for badug-kadup: https://confluence.zemvarlabs.internal/projects/browse/display/projects/bd1b

## Formula sandbox tuning

User-supplied formulas in Gridmoor execute inside a restricted interpreter with hard ceilings on time, memory, and call depth. Reviewers should confirm any change to these ceilings is justified in the PR description, since raising them widens the abuse surface. Defaults were chosen from production traces. The current limits are as follows.

limits module of tafog-fawip:
WEIGHTS = {
    "julix": 57,
    "lamys": 992,
    "kasvan": 209,
    "quenok": 750,
    "alddor": 259,
    "oliath": 1009,
    "wenix": 815,
}

## Ownership: Gateway Rate Limiting

Rate limiting in the Spindle internal API gateway uses a token-bucket per client key, with limits defined in the gateway-policies repo. Future maintainers should never edit limits directly in production; change the policy file and redeploy. Questions about limit tuning, quota exceptions, or burst configuration go to the owner named below.

named custodian: Brivan Eliath Quenox Frador

**Wiki — Managers Only: Pilot Churn**

The Brightmoor pilot lost 14 of 60 customers in its first quarter, mostly citing onboarding friction. Retention improved after the Helvan team simplified setup. Churn now tracks at 6% monthly. Before your first review meeting, please read the note that follows.

confidential, kagup-bafog: Fraaxax Group is in early talks to buy Soroxox Group for about $343.8 million. The Olidor launch date is June 14, and nothing goes to the press before then. Legal wants the Aldmirek Logistics term sheet signed before July 23.